One of the most important components of a system for getting more media interviews is a pitch file. This is a folder, or maybe a notebook, or some software online – I use Evernote – that allows you to capture ideas and articles for use later.

In whatever field you work in, you will have one or more topics that are right up your alley. You should definitely pitch those ideas to reporters, producers and show hosts. You just can’t keep pitching that same topic over and over.

Instead, you want a large number of ideas ready for when you want to pitch one of them. That’s why it’s important to have somewhere to put ideas right when you see or read them instead of having to remember them later.

It’s also important to come up with ideas that will interest those reporters and producers. And one of the best places I have found to come up with interesting pitch ideas is People magazine.
